Create a cartridge that functions in the AR-15 platform that doesn’t just work for hunting big game- but excels: This is what Trident Armory’s owner James Collins tasked his staff with in early 2013.
“I don’t want to get into the AR-10 business- but I want AR-10 performance. I’m tired of people being excited about cartridges in the AR-15 platform that only perform adequately. I want to work backwards- look at what room we have, and maximize the space available without trying to reinvent the wheel.” The requirements were simple- move a classic big game bullet at classic big game killing speeds, and make it function in this small platform…
Trident Armory’s head of development Dan LaChance came back with the solution to the problem- “it has to be 358 diameter,” he said “or else we just aren’t using the available capacity effectively. We have enough variation in bullet weight available to meet everyone’s needs.”
Answer: Trident Armory’s 358 Trident AR-Mag. (patent pending)
The 358 Trident AR-MAG doesn’t just get the job done. It doesn’t toss a projectile of modest weight at marginal speed. It hurls a 200 grain rifle projectile at over 2550 fps, and that’s just the beginning. 180 grain bullets are breaking 2600 fps and 150’s are at a sizzling 2680+ fps.
The Trident 358 AR-Mag is legitimately capable of killing big game, and not just out to 200 yards. Sighted in at 200 yards, 200gr bullets fall only 10.8” shy of bullseye at 300 yards, and are just a mere 2.8” high at 100 yards.
The new round’s energy is nothing to sneeze at either- Boasting a massive 26.8 Taylor Knock Out Value, compared to only 22TKO from a 30-06 with a bullet of the same weight
